Ingredients

To whip up this delightful salad, you will need:

  • 3 bell peppers (choose a mix of colors: red, yellow, green)
  • 1 small red onion
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es
  • 1 cucumber
  • 1/4 cup fresh parsley (or your favorite herbs)
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ar (or lemon juice for a zesty twist)
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Optional Add-Ins

  • Feta cheese or goat cheese for creaminess
  • Canned chickpeas for added protein
  • Avocado for healthy fats
  • Nuts or seeds for crunch

Instructions

  1. Prep the Ingredients: Start by washing all the vegetables thoroughly. Dice the bell peppers, slice the red onion, halve the cherry tomatoes, and chop the cucumber into bite-sized pieces.

  2. Combine: In a large bowl, combine all the chopped vegetables. Toss gently to mix them.

  3. Dress the Salad: In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, balsamic vinegar, salt, and pepper. Drizzle the dressing over the salad and toss again to ensure everything is coated.

  4. Garnish: Sprinkle fresh parsley (or your choice of herbs) over the top for an added layer of flavor.

  5. Serve: Enjoy immediately, or let it chill in the refrigerator for about 30 minutes to let the flavors meld together.

Tips for the Best Bell Pepper Salad

  • Use Fresh Ingredients: The fresher your veggies, the better the salad will taste. Opt for in-season bell peppers and crisp vegetables.
  • Add Some Spice: If you enjoy a little heat, consider adding sliced jalapeños or a dash of hot sauce.
  • Meal Prep Friendly: This salad keeps well in the fridge, making it great for meal prep. Just remember to keep the dressing separate until you’re ready to serve to maintain the crispness of the vegetables.
